Searched refs:VariableMap (Results 1 – 3 of 3) sorted by relevance
40 using VariableMap = ArenaUnorderedMap<util::StringView, Variable *>; variable310 VariableMap *GetEnumMembers() const in GetEnumMembers()324 void SetEnumMembers(VariableMap *enumMemberBindings) in SetEnumMembers()330 VariableMap *enumMemberBindings_ {nullptr};
43 using VariableMap = ArenaUnorderedMap<util::StringView, Variable *>; variable55 tsBindings_[index] = allocator_->New<VariableMap>(allocator_->Adapter()); in AddTSVariable()92 std::array<VariableMap *, static_cast<size_t>(TSBindingType::COUNT)> tsBindings_ {};136 VariableMap exportBindings_;302 VariableMap &Bindings() in Bindings()307 const VariableMap &Bindings() const in Bindings()367 VariableMap bindings_;782 …explicit TSEnumScope(ArenaAllocator *allocator, Scope *parent, VariableMap *enumMemberBindings) : … in TSEnumScope()818 VariableMap *enumMemberBindings_;
3158 …res->AsEnumLiteralVariable()->SetEnumMembers(Allocator()->New<binder::VariableMap>(Allocator()->Ad… in ParseEnumDeclaration()3160 binder::VariableMap *enumMemberBindings = res->AsEnumLiteralVariable()->GetEnumMembers(); in ParseEnumDeclaration()